Asset Management
Asset management is the practice of providing the greatest benefits from these assets in the most cost-effective manner. It establishes the process for operation, maintenance, renewal, refurbishment and upgrade of Council’s assets.
Asset management activities Include:
- Life cycle costing of Council assets to achieve best value
- Undertake asset acquisition, replacement and rehabilitation
- Current and future service planning to deliver the best outcomes for the community within the financial constraints of Council’s budgets
- Developing and undertaking asset condition assessments
- Analysis of asset condition data to determine and schedule asset replacement and rehabilitation
